Output e252017808ef2fedfc475e15f3ea4a89edebfaf418cefcd3891d44ca661d7cef:0

value
178716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aa878ececbe4d657440e0937c2c93554e063cf1 OP_EQUAL
address
3CsaBcTjbfAtZCzH5dJkwgbA5E1v7AD5BH
transaction
e252017808ef2fedfc475e15f3ea4a89edebfaf418cefcd3891d44ca661d7cef
confirmations
314853
spent
true